1963 Chevy Corvette Sting Ray Fuelie Convertible Up For Grabs In Giveaway

Sponsored Links General Motors debuted the second-generation C2 Chevy Corvette for the 1963 model year, introducing a smaller body with newly restyled body panels and the Sting Ray nameplate, plus a host of performance-adding specs and modernized equipment under the skin. Now, Corvette fans have a chance to put this gorgeous numbers-matching 1963 Chevy Corvette Sting Ray “Fuelie” Convertible in their garage via a sweepstakes hosted by the Auburn Cord Duesenberg Automobile Museum. For those readers who don’t know, the Auburn Cord Duesenberg Automobile Museum in Auburn, Indiana offers visitors a chance to see more than 140 classic, vintage, and antique vehicles, all of which are on display in the rescued ‘30s-era administration building of the Auburn Automobile Company. The museum first opened its doors in 1974, and now, its offering Chevy Corvette fans a chance to win this ’63 droptop with a fundraising sweepstakes to support the non-profit museum.
